The Toyota Foundation has announced a funding call "Cultivating Empathy Through Learning from Our Neighbors: Practitioners' Exchange on Common Issues in Asia" under 2022 International Grant Program.
The grant program focuses on deepening mutual understanding and knowledge-sharing among people on the ground in East Asia, Southeast Asia, and South Asia who are finding solutions to shared issues.
Through promoting direct interaction among key players, the grant program aims to survey and analyze situations in target countries, obtain new perspectives, and expand the potential of future generations.

This program provides grants for projects in all areas that meet the five points of the "Toyota Foundation's Guiding Principles for Grants" and focus on new common issues facing two or more of the countries and regions in East Asia, Southeast Asia, and South Asia.
The Toyota Foundation finds great social significance not only in addressing current social issues, but also in identifying emerging issues before they become readily apparent.
